Output 043586d89ae2e6f2c0791cb5ea2dc26b57f8f8f1ac929ed37a65a240993727a6:0

value
6637281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3b47ed5d9173c7731527c31be17576ad96c685f OP_EQUAL
address
3GccHrbRS785YX3QZH3phSvmxGGwQNrCxz
transaction
043586d89ae2e6f2c0791cb5ea2dc26b57f8f8f1ac929ed37a65a240993727a6
spent
true